Top TV Characters to Dress Up As: Ultimate Costume Guide

Choosing tv characters to dress up as can turn any party into a memorable night. These iconic roles give you instant recognition and let you express personality through bold costumes, props, and attitude.

Below is a detailed guide that helps you compare options, plan budgets, and choose looks that match your comfort and style.

Character Show / Year Iconic Look Difficulty
Phoebe Buffay Friends (1994–2004) Bohemian dresses, fringe, acoustic guitar Easy
Walter White Breaking Bad (2008–2013) Gray hoodie, sunglasses, goatee kit Medium
Daenerys Targaryen Game of Thrones (2011–2019) Silver wig, dragon pins, layered crowns Hard
Michael Scott The Office (US) (2005–2013) Pastel button shirt, red mug, uncomfortable tie Easy
Loki Laufeyson Loki (2021–present) Green cape, regal boots, theatrical mask Medium
Wednesday Addams Wednesday (2022–present) Black dress, braided hair, skeleton arm Medium

Casual Party Looks

Comfortable characters for low-key events

For laid-back gatherings, pick tv characters to dress up as that prioritize comfort and easy movement. Friends remains a top source, with Phoebe’s bohemian vibe and Ross’s quirky scientist tee requiring simple thrift finds and minimal makeup.

Michael Scott from The Office is another excellent casual choice, relying on a pastel button shirt, visible belly, and a poorly tied tie to land authentic humor without complex tailoring.

High-Impact Drama Looks

Bold costumes that command attention at themed events

When you want tv characters to dress up as figures that dominate the room, turn to prestige dramas. Walter White immediately signals danger and transformation with his gray hoodie and ballcap, while subtle contact lenses can heighten the transformation without heavy prosthetics.

Daenerys Targaryen demands dramatic fabrics, layered jewelry, and a carefully styled silver wig, making her ideal for costume contests where craftsmanship and presence matter most.

Wit and Pop Culture References

Characters that reward fan knowledge with laughter

Comedy driven costumes thrive on sharp references, and Loki Laufeyson delivers with his green cape and theatrical mask that hint at mischief. Pair the outfit with a playful grin and a mock serious tone to trigger instant recognition.

Wednesday Addams offers another witty path, where black dresses, braided hair, and a detachable skeleton arm create a look that is morbid, stylish, and conversation-starting in equal measure.

Budget and Crafting Tips

How to balance cost, time, and authenticity

Before committing to tv characters to dress up as, evaluate your budget and timeline. Simple ensembles like Michael Scott or Phoebe Buffay can be assembled for under fifty dollars using thrift clothing and a printed logo prop.

Medium investments in wigs, contact lenses, and tailoring pay off for characters like Loki and Walter White, while premium looks such as Daenerys may require renting or commissioning pieces to achieve screen accurate results.
